Custom benchmarks
If you have your own salary survey data or internal compensation bands, you can upload them as a CSV to override TeamCalc's built-in benchmarks.
Exporting current benchmarks
Click Export CSV on the Benchmarks page or team view to download the current benchmark data. This gives you a template with the correct column format.
The export includes columns for role type, seniority, region, company stage, and salary percentiles (p25, p50, p75).
CSV format
Your CSV should include these columns:
| Column | Required | Example | |---|---|---| | Role | Yes | Software Engineer | | Seniority | Yes | Senior | | Region | No | London | | Company Stage | No | Series A | | P25 Salary (£) | Yes | 65000 | | Median Salary (£) | Yes | 75000 | | P75 Salary (£) | Yes | 88000 |
Column headers are flexible — TeamCalc recognises common aliases (e.g. "P50" for median).
Uploading
Click Import CSV and select your file. TeamCalc compares your data against existing benchmarks:
- New entries — roles/regions not in the current data are added
- Overrides — figures differing by more than £500 from built-in data are flagged as overrides
- Matches — figures within £500 tolerance are treated as confirmations (not overrides)
Review the diff summary before confirming the import.
Limits
- Maximum 500 rows per upload
- Available on Pro and Growth plans
- Growth plan users can additionally export filtered CSV subsets
Removing custom data
Custom benchmarks can be removed individually or in bulk from the Benchmarks management view.
